Transaction 711739770e72bdbd14f9a31f25059988d2d6ea41802a6524f2ae319ff2e6a359

1 Input
1 Outputs
  • 711739770e72bdbd14f9a31f25059988d2d6ea41802a6524f2ae319ff2e6a359:0
  • value  805998
    address  3LuWimm9YW1qGqVE2GavGdBZ4VT59jdZzi